Overview:
Epithalon is a synthetic tetrapeptide used in research for its potential to activate telomerase, an enzyme associated with cellular regeneration and longevity. It is widely studied for its anti-aging properties and potential therapeutic applications in extending cellular lifespan.
Key Features:
- Anti-Aging Effects: Epithalon is known for its potential to slow down the aging process by activating telomerase, an enzyme that helps maintain telomere length and cellular health.
- Telomerase Activation: Research indicates that Epithalon can stimulate telomerase activity, which is crucial for maintaining genomic stability and promoting cellular longevity.
- Cellular Regeneration: Epithalon may enhance cellular regeneration, making it valuable for studies on tissue repair and longevity.
- Mechanism of Action: Works by promoting telomere elongation, potentially delaying the natural aging process at the cellular level.
